Noun [English]

Forms: carromatas [plural]
Etymology: From Spanish carromato + -a. Etymology templates: {{bor|en|es|-}} Spanish, {{suffix|es|carromato|-a|nocat=1}} carromato + -a Head templates: {{en-noun}} carromata (plural carromatas)
  1. (Philippines, historical) A light two-wheeled box-like vehicle usually drawn by a single native pony and used to convey passengers within city limits or for travelling. Tags: Philippines, historical Categories (topical): Vehicles
